Mélanie Meillard (born 23 September 1998) is a Swiss World Cup alpine ski racer,[1] who specialises in the technical events of Slalom and Giant slalom.
Meillard made her World Cup debut at age 17 in December 2015; her older brother Loïc is also a World Cup alpine racer.
In December 2019 and January 2020, Meillard attempted a comeback, but ended the season after three races without a countable result.
She finally managed to return to the top of the world at the beginning of the 2020/21 season, when she finished ninth in the Levi slalom.
